Why use a rowing machine

Rowing machines offer a great workout for your entire body. They're lightweight, so they're gentle on joints and work both your lower and upper body. Rowing machines are also an excellent way to get your heart rate going and boost your fitness. There are three kinds of rowing machines that include air rowers, water rowers, as well as magnetic rowers. Air rowers use a fan to create resistance, water rowers employ paddles set in a pool water to create resistance magnetic rowers employ magnets to generate resistance. Each kind of rowing machine comes with its own advantages and drawbacks. Air rowers are the most affordable, but they're also likely to be loud and cause a lot vibration. Water rowers are quieter option, but they're also the most expensive. The magnetic rowers are in the middle in terms of price, but they have a easy rowing that's very gentle on joints.
